Responsibilities:

  • Design and install R&D prototypes for alternative fueled commercial vehicles and machines.
  • Develop component and system designs, specifying and sourcing necessary components.
  • Design wiring looms and build prototype wiring harnesses for low and high voltage systems.
  • Conduct validation testing of components and systems as required.
  • Prepare and maintain R&D Bills of Materials (BOMs).
  • Set up and configure CAN-based systems.
  • Collect and analyze data to inform decision-making.
  • Collaborate effectively within a team on various projects.
